Top 3 Reasons for a Manufacturing Plant to Invest in a 3D Printer

Posted by Ftoptimus 3dprinter on February 7th, 2020

3D printers are high in demand these days by multiple manufacturing plants and companies around the world. Companies spend a lot of money on these 3D printers simply because they are way more cost-effective for the company. Wondering why and how these 3D printers make a difference to the manufacturing process of the products? Here are a few benefits on having a 3D printer in your manufacturing unit –

Easier to edit design in nascent stage


It is important to note that the design cannot be changed without incurring loses when the final product is ready. This is why so many companies invest their money in large format 3D printer and similar 3D printer CNC laser cutter so that edits can be made in the nascent stages.

When you have a simple 3D printer, it becomes easier to have all the items cut effectively and altered in the sample and then further edits can be made to this too. With a final product, everything needs to be done all over again from scratch which can add to the costs and time taken as well!

Improves efficiency


The overall efficiency of your company goes up significantly when you invest in a high-quality optimus 3D printer for sale. This is mainly because the overall manufacturing processes become a lot more streamlined with a 3D printer installed! You don’t have to worry about losing time and money by only refereeing to the final batch of products when you can in fact, refer to a sample product in the beginning itself.

The teams have a better understanding of what will and what won’t work in the product when they see a 3D model in person. This helps to get an actual feel of the product and accordingly, changes are made to the design which will save them from a lot of confusion as well.
